/*
 * RestockPilot client setup — for external plugin authors.
 * This client talks to the Corridor restock-planning API: it pulls
 * machine inventory snapshots, predicts sell-through, and returns a
 * suggested restock route. Plugins must call init() before any
 * planner methods. Rate limit: 60 req/min per plugin. Sandbox data
 * only; production machines are off-limits. Initialize the client
 * with the key below.
 */

API key for bahop-yajog: qvz3-mhf

Root causes: vendor attrition at Quennet Systems, underscoped data migration, and the Bramfield pilot absorbing key engineers. Budget overrun currently 14%.

Actions: migration rescoped, two contractors onboarded, weekly checkpoint with the Avenor steering group. Incoming director to own escalation from next sprint.

Do not circulate beyond manager tier. Customer commitments tied to Larkspur remain unchanged externally. Context on why the timeline is politically sensitive is appended below.

confidential, bahof-yaweg: Headcount on the Kaseth team goes from 32 to 109 by the end of January. Gross margin on Kaseth came in at 46 percent against a plan of 45 percent.

Partner SFTP Drop — Quick Notes

Vendra Logistics uploads manifests nightly to the partner drop. Files land as gzipped CSVs; the ingest job picks them up within 15 minutes. If a file stalls, check the ingest worker logs first, then the quarantine folder for malformed rows.

Do not re-run ingest manually without confirming the partner finished uploading. Escalate repeated failures to the data platform rotation.

To verify rows landed, query the staging database directly using the connection string below.

primary connection of tawif-yajeg = postgresql://rusiel_svc:G879q9cx6GsSvj@db-dd9f.norvagrid.internal:5432/casath

// Setup for DedupeDesk, the internal service that collapses duplicate
// on-call alerts before they reach the pager queue. Dedup window is
// 5 minutes, keyed on alert fingerprint. If the service is unreachable
// we fail open and forward everything raw.
// The client authenticates with the key that follows.

app token of kafop-hahaf = kto11_iRLdsMBafGn